Rourkela, Feb 11 (IANS) Belgium defeated India 3-1 during the Rourkela leg of the FIH Men’s Pro League 2025–26 on Wednesday at the Birsa Munda Hockey Stadium. Nelson Onana (23′), Thomas Crols (53′) and Arno Van Dessel (57′) scored the goals for Belgium while Shilanand Lakra (29′) was the goalscorer for India. Bhubaneswar, Jan 2 (IANS) Hyderabad Toofans clinched the third place in the Hockey India League (HIL) 2026, defeating HIL GC 4-3 in a high-scoring thriller at the Kalinga Hockey Stadium in Bhubaneswar on Monday.Amandeep Lakra (30’, 53) bagged a brace with Nilakanta Sharma (24’) and Jacob Anderson (33’) also getting on the scoresheet for the Toofans.
